A production controller is responsible for overseeing the planning, coordination, and execution of manufacturing processes to ensure efficient and timely production. They work closely with various departments such as procurement, inventory management, and operations to monitor production schedules, track progress, and resolve any issues that may arise during the production process. Additionally, they analyze production data to identify areas for improvement and implement strategies to increase productivity and reduce costs.

Production Controller salary in Denmark
Average Yearly Salary of Production Controller in Denmark is approximately 624,398 DKK (89,270 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. Denmark is a Scandinavian country located in Northern Europe. It has a population of approximately 5.8 million people and covers an area of around 43,094 square kilometers. The country consists of the Jutland Peninsula and numerous islands, including Zealand, Funen, and Bornholm.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 494,627 DKK (73,200 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Production Controller job salary compared to average salary in Denmark.
Comparison shows that a person working as Production Controller in Denmark earns on average:
1.26 times the average salary (or 126% of average salary).
